Fitted sheets are only specific to the mattress size that you bought them for so it is of great importance that you know the specific mattress size that you have prior to buying your sheets.

Each mattress size has corresponding fitted sheet dimensions so before you get your sheet, check the type of mattress that you have whether it is a Twin, Full, Queen or King.

Mattresses Types and Sizes

If you don’t know the exact dimensions of your mattress type, you can check out the following to determine the general dimensions of specific mattress types.

For Standard American Sizes:

Twin - thirty-nine inches by seventy-five inches

Full - fifty-four inches by seventy-five inches

Queen - sixty inches by eighty inches

King - seventy-six inches by eighty inches

California King - seventy-two inches by eighty-four inches

For UK Standard Sizes:

Single - thirty-six inches by seventy-five inches

Double - fifty-four inches by seventy-five inches

King - sixty inches by seventy-eight inches

Super King - seventy-two inches by seventy-eight inches

You will find that there is a small difference between US mattress sizes and UK mattress sizes.

However, since you are getting fitted sheets, the small discrepancy in dimensions can make a huge difference in that get one that is only an inch smaller or bigger and you will be getting a fitted sheet that wouldn’t quite snuggly fit your mattress.

Fitted Sheet Dimensions

As for the fitted sheet sizes, see the following measurements:

US Standard Sizes:

Twin - thirty-nine inches wide by seventy-six inches long by eight inches deep

Full - fifty-four inches wide by seventy-six inches long by eight inches deep

Queen - sixty inches wide by eighty inches long by eight inches deep

King - seventy-six inches wide by eighty inches long by eight inches deep

California King - seventy-three inches wide by eighty-five inches long by eight inches deep

UK Standard Sizes

Single - ninety centimeters wide by one hundred and ninety centimeter long by twenty centimeters deep

Double - one hundred and forty centimeters wide by two hundred centimeters long by twenty centimeters deep

King - one hundred and sixty centimeters wide by two hundred centimeters long by twenty centimeters deep

Super King - two hundred centimeters wide by two hundred centimeters long by twenty centimeters deep
